To Reduce Disaster Risk, We Must Recognize and Address Complex Links Between Humans and Wildlife

Writer's picture: SEAOHUN SEAOHUN

"Thus, to reduce the risk of future pandemics, disaster risk management practitioners need to expand the concept of exposure to zoonotic pathogens beyond the immediate hazard and consider the complex chain of environmental stresses and intermediate interactions that link people and wildlife." - Gabrielle Iglesias, Senior Monitoring, Evaluation and Learning Officer at SEAOHUN
